Hello

we just bought a yerf dog spiderbox, with Howhit 150cc engine. We replaced the carburetor (however when we bought it the carburetor was new but it was leaking by the air filter so we replaced). We connected all the wiring. It will only start while you pad the throttle and hold the start button. It will idle. The carburetor is now leaking out of the air filter. Also when we hit the brake the engine will cut off. I'm at a loss of what could be wrong. Thinking maybe something with the starter clutch. Any ideas that could be helpful? I really appreciate it

If the engine quits when you step on the brake, it sounds like a problem with the wiring. Leaking gas out of the air filter two things come to mind. The cam is installed wrong ( highly unlikely. This requires opening up the engine. ) Or this kart is equipped with an electric choke, and it is stuck in the on position. There again this would be caused by an electrical problem. ( much more likely ). If you aren't pretty good with engines, and even better with electric trouble shooting, I would recommend you look on Craigslist. The choke is an electric pintle. It's retracted cold to allow full fuel flow then as the engine warms up the pintle extends into the carb port to limit fuel flow. The 150cc engine usually ships with a vacuum fuel valve mounted under the gas tank that opens from engine vacuum. If the fuel valve is bad it will allow fuel to flow and flood the engine. Pull the hose from the valve with the engine off & see if it's leaking.

I'm guessing you have it wired wrong. The starter clutch shouldn't have anything to do with it, the clutch is a one way sprag that locks while cranking the engine but releases once the engine starts. Refer to this manual.
